Hati-hati ketika membuat manajemen link melalui javascript dalam web / situs anda !

Dalam suatu web yang dinamis, selalu ada penambahan artikel dan berita.Di setiap artikel atau berita tersebut ada bagian yang berisi penjelasan artikel dan satu  bagian lagi berisi daftar artikel atau berita yang ada berikut linknya.
 
Jika kita melakukan pembuatan artikel secara manual di dalam membuat file html, maka setiap kali kita menambah artikel, maka kita harus menambahkan judul artikel baru dan linknya ke seluruh artikel yang sudah ada supaya bisa saling link. Bayangkan kalau ada 20 artikel yang sudah ada, maka setiap kali ada artikel baru kita harus mengedit 20 artikel yang lainnya. Hal ini sangat merepotkan. Harus ada jalan untuk mengatasi hal ini.
 
Manajemen link melalui satu file javascript
Ada programmer yang mengatasi hal ini dengan menempatkan seluruh link file dalam sebuah file javascript misalnya daftar_artikel.js yang berisi misalnya :

document.write("<br><a href=pembuatan_web.htm>Pembuatan Web</a>");
document.write("<br><a href=promosi_web.htm>Promosi Web</a>");
document.write("<br><a href=pemeliharaan_web.htm>Pemeliharaan Web</a>");


Kemudian masing-masing file (pembuatan_web.htm, promosi_web.htm,pemeliharaan_web.htm) tersebut memanggil file daftar_artikel.js tersebut melalui statement :
<script language=javascript src=daftar_artikel.js></script> .

Ide ini memang baik dilihat dari segi pemecahan masalah. Setiap kali ada penambahan file artikel yang baru, untuk judul dan link filenya cukup ditambahkan dalam file daftar_artikel.js.
Tetapi ada hal lain yang perlu dipertimbangkan. Search engine seperti Google tidak bisa mengindex file-file yang dilink melalui javascript. Jadi harus ada cara lain supaya manajemen link mudah tetapi search engine bisa mengindeks situs anda dengan baik.

Manajemen link melalui satu file php
Untuk manajement link melalui satu file php maka semua file harus ber-extension php, dan tentu saja dalam web server yang mendukung bahasa pemrograman php.
Daftar artikel dan linknya dikumpulkan dalam satu file misalnya daftar_artikel.php yang berisi:

<br><a href=pembuatan_web.php>Pembuatan Web /a>
<br><a href=promosi_web.php>Promosi Web</a>
<br><a href=pemeliharaan_web.php>PemeliharaanWeb </a>

Kemudian masing-masing file tersebut (pembuatan_web.php, promosi_web.php,pemeliharaan_web.php) memanggil file daftar_artikel.php melalui statement:

include "daftar_artikel.php";

Dengan cara ini maka manajement file menjadi mudah dan search engine juga mengindeks situs anda.

Link dalam pull down menu
Bagaimana dengan link dalam pulldown menu, karena kalau pakai link secara manual filenya besar ?
Jika mempertimbangkan kondisi ukuran file tetap efisien dan search engine / mesin pencari tetap bisa mengindeks web anda dengan baik maka berikut langkah-langkahnya:
1. harus ada link manual antara menu utama
2. harus ada link manual antara sub menu dengan suatu menu utama
3. harus ada link manual antar sub menu dalam suatu menu utama
4. harus ada link manual antara artikel dengan suatu sub menu
5. harus ada link manual antar artikel dalam suatu sub menu
6. selebihnya link-link yang lain (misal link antar sub menu dalam menu utama yang berbeda) boleh diletakkan dalam file javascript

ProWeb , sebagai Professional Web Developer di Jakarta, Indonesia berusaha memberikan yang terbaik dalam pengembangan website / situs di Indonesia.
Kunjungi selalu www.prowebpro.com untuk mendapatkan tips-tips pengembangan web site.

Web Design Packages

Paket BasicPaket BusinessPaket Corporate

Address

PT. Proweb Indonesia

 

Please visit: www.proweb.co.id